Off-site run checklist — Item 6: Weekly cash-box run

Office manager to confirm before release: cash box counted by two staff, tally slip signed and sealed inside, outer seal number recorded in the Marwick register, safe log updated, and the Copperline Couriers booking reference checked against the schedule. Once all boxes above are ticked, the courier hand-over instruction applies as stated below.

dispatch memo: the eliok quenok courier leaves the sorael aldath belion tammir casix gileth queniel jorath ledger at gate 9299 under passcode 897989

Q: How do I load test the Cartfell checkout flow before merging? A: Good news — you don't have to invent anything. We keep a canned scenario suite in Stressply that simulates browse, add-to-cart, and payment confirmation at ramped concurrency. Run it against the staging stack only, never prod, and keep runs under 20 minutes so you don't starve other reviewers. If p95 latency stays under 800ms at 500 virtual users, you're fine to approve. Setup steps and result thresholds are documented on the internal page.

runbook for badug-kadup: https://confluence.zemvarlabs.internal/projects/browse/display/projects/bd1b

**Vendor note: Inkmill markdown pipeline**

Rendering for Parchway docs is outsourced to Inkmill under an annual contract, renewing each March. They handle sanitization and PDF export; we own the upload queue. SLA: 4-hour response on rendering failures. Escalate only after two failed retries. Their support desk is reachable at the address below.

billing contact of hahaf-baguf = zorael.tammir.jorius@sivrelhq.internal